Postcard depicting a sketch of the interior courtyard of an old fort. The description on the verso reads, 'Fort Jefferson, Dry Tortugas, Florida. Located 60 miles west of Key West, this old fort was started before the Civil War. The major role played by the fort was that of a prison. The most famous prisoner incarcerated here was Dr. Samuel A. Mudd, who gave medical attention to Booth, President Lincoln's slayer.'Collection
